Norwegian super-talented musician Harleif Langas, better known as the mastermind behind dark ambient legends NORTHAUNT strikes back with his parallel creature THE HUMAN VOICE. Giving voice to a less dark and oppressive journey, "Exit lines" shows how subtle is the boundary between ambient (not necessarily dark....) music and spacious post-rock. Deep drones and sparse melodic guitar lines, "skeletal" structures and subtle noises. These thin exit lines will appeal to both the Constellation-freaks and the courageous (and open minded) dark ambient travellers.
